Abstract

It is analyzing the legal status of human rights treaties in the Brazilian legal system, in view of the changes introduced by the Amendment to the Constitution n. 45/04, known as the Judiciary Reform. Such amendment brought the possibility of the human rights treaties being likened to constitutional amendments and therefore have constitutional legal status. However, he remained silent with regard to approved treated before its enactment. However, the Supreme Court gave supra-legal status to that treaty. Must be examined to what extent this constitutional change brought greater protection of human rights, therefore it closely examines the Convention on the Rights of Persons with Disabilities, adopted in the form of paragraph 3 of article 5 of the Federal Constitution of 1988.
